A tribute to my S Type.

I was first at a set of traffic lights on red.

The lights changed and I started across the junction, only to see a car coming towards me at high speed from my left with no chance or intention of stopping for the junction.

There was a Police car behind the approaching vehicle, clearly in pursuit and I was in prime position to be "T-Boned".

I pushed the throttle hard and she answered admirably, with kick in the back acceleration, clearing the junction with a fraction of a second to spare.

That was quite as close as I ever want to be to such a situation.

I've been T-Boned before, in my first Rover 75, and that was at relatively low speed. This wouldn't have ended happily at the speed the other car was travelling.
